-
Skechers GOrun Series: The Skechers GOrun Series focuses on lightweight cushioning and responsive support. This line features a breathable mesh upper and HyperBurst foam, which provides excellent energy return. The GOrun 7 has gained popularity for its versatility, making it suitable for both running and walking on the treadmill.
-
Skechers GOwalk Series: The Skechers GOwalk Series is designed for walking. This series is known for its comfort due to the Air-Cooled Goga Mat insole and lightweight construction. The GOwalk 5 particularly appeals to users needing extra padding for longer treadmill sessions. Its slip-on design adds convenience for quick wear.
-
Skechers Sport Series: The Skechers Sport Series offers both style and function for gym-goers. These shoes typically feature Memory Foam insoles, which provide custom comfort. The Skechers Sport Energy Afterburn model is favored for its durable design and reliable grip, making it suitable for various treadmill activities.
-
Skechers Max Cushioning Series: The Max Cushioning Series stands out for its thick cushioning, ideal for runners seeking comfort during longer treadmill runs. The Max Cushioning Elite utilizes Ultra Go foam for superior cushioning and support, reducing impact during workouts. Users often report less fatigue from extended use.
-
Skechers Arch Fit Series: The Arch Fit Series focuses on providing arch support. This series includes models designed to support those with flat feet or various arch types. The Arch Fit Journey features a removable insole and is often recommended by podiatrists for its alignment capabilities. Users appreciate the added support during treadmill workouts.

How Can You Extend the Lifespan of Your Skechers Treadmill Shoes?
To extend the lifespan of your Skechers treadmill shoes, you should focus on proper cleaning, storage, usage practices, and regular maintenance.
Proper cleaning is essential to maintain shoe structure.
– Clean the shoes regularly using a damp cloth to remove dirt and debris. This prevents build-up that can damage materials.
– Avoid submerging the shoes in water. Excess moisture can compromise the shoe’s cushioning and materials.
Storage can significantly affect the shoe’s durability.
– Store your shoes in a cool, dry place away from direct sunlight. Heat and light can degrade materials over time.
– Use a shoe rack or box to keep the shoes properly shaped and prevent crushing.
Usage practices also play a critical role in extending lifespan.
– Reserve your treadmill shoes for running or walking only on treadmills. Using them on rough surfaces can cause faster wear.
– Rotate your shoes with another pair to allow them to rest. This can prevent excessive compression of materials.
Regular maintenance helps keep shoes in optimal condition.
– Check for wear and tear on the soles regularly. A worn sole can reduce traction, impacting safety.
– Replace insoles when they lose cushioning. New insoles can provide additional support and prolong the life of the shoes.
By following these practices, you can significantly extend the lifespan of your Skechers treadmill shoes.
